Função ISLOGICAL do Excel - Testa se a célula resulta em lógica

Baixar exemplo de pasta de trabalho

Baixe a apostila de exemplo

Este tutorial demonstra como usar o Função ISLOGICAL Excel no Excel para testar se uma célula é um valor lógico.

Visão geral da função ISLOGICAL

O teste de função ISLOGICAL se a célula é lógica (TRUE ou FALSE). Retorna TRUE ou FALSE.

Para usar a função ISLOGICAL Excel Worksheet, selecione uma célula e digite:

(Observe como as entradas da fórmula aparecem)

Sintaxe e entradas da função ISLOGICAL:

1 = ISLOGICAL (VALUE)

valor - O valor de teste

Como usar a função ISLOGICAL

A função ISLOGICAL testa se uma célula contém uma expressão lógica (TRUE ou FALSE). Se a célula contiver uma expressão lógica, ela retornará TRUE, caso contrário, retornará FALSE.

1 = ISLOGICAL (A2)

Se é lógico

Normalmente, depois de realizar um teste lógico, você desejará fazer algo com base no resultado desse teste. A função IF pode ser usada para executar ações diferentes se uma instrução for avaliada como TRUE ou FALSE. Vamos usá-lo com a função ISLOGICAL.

1 = SE (ISLOGICAL (A2), "lógico", "não lógico")

Se não for lógico

A função NOT inverte os resultados lógicos. Ele muda de TRUE para FALSE e FALSE para TRUE. Aqui podemos usar isso com a função IF:

1 = SE (NÃO (ISLÓGICO (A2)), "não lógico", "lógico")

Outras funções lógicas

O Excel / Planilhas Google contém muitas outras funções lógicas para realizar outros testes lógicos. Aqui está uma lista:

Funções IF / IS
iferror
iserror
isna
iserr
está em branco
isnumber
istext
isnontext
isformula
islógico
isref
iseven
é estranho

ISLOGICAL no Planilhas Google

A função ISLOGICAL funciona exatamente da mesma forma no Planilhas Google e no Excel:

Exemplos ISLÓGICOS em VBA

Você também pode usar a função ISLOGICAL no VBA. Modelo:
application.worksheetfunction.islogical (valor)
Para os argumentos da função (valor, etc.), você pode inseri-los diretamente na função ou definir as variáveis ​​a serem usadas.

Voltar para a lista de todas as funções no Excel

wave wave wave wave wave